Catchment Description
Diamond Creek is a tributary of the Yarra River that rises on the Kinglake Plateau and flows south- westerly into the Yarra past St Andrews, Hurstbridge, Diamond Creek and Eltham.

Diamond Creek is a settlement in the Diamond Valley and takes its name from a tributary of the Yarra River on account of crystalline stones observed on the creek bed. Originally called Nillumbik, Diamond Creek was included in the area claimed by John Batman's Port Phillip Association in 1835.What is there to do at Diamond Creek?

Are there diamonds in Diamond Creek?
Its name is deceiving. No diamonds were ever discovered at Diamond Creek, but it was a hot spot during the gold rush. Three prospectors first discovered the precious metal here in 1863, and between ₤1,000,000 and ₤2,000,000 worth of gold was extracted from the mine that opened some years later.Where is Diamond Creek AZ?
